Plant outages trigger red alerts in Visayas, Mindanao

THE National Grid Corp. of the Philippines (NGCP) placed the Visayas and Mindanao grids under red and yellow alerts on Wednesday, as widespread power plant outages reduced supply amid high demand.

A red alert is issued when the power supply is insufficient to meet consumer demand and the transmission grid’s regulating reserve requirement.A yellow alert is raised when the available operating margin is insufficient to meet the grid’s contingency reserve requirement.In the Visayas, a red alert was raised from 1 to 10 p.m., followed by a yellow alert from 10 to 11 p.m. Peak demand was projected at 2,555 megawatts (MW), against an available capacity of only 2,124 MW.NGCP said 33 power plants in the region were on forced outage, while 13 others were operating at reduced capacity. The outages and deratings removed a combined 982.6 MW from the grid.In Mindanao, a red alert was scheduled from 2 to 4 p.m. and from 5 to 8 p.m.Yellow alerts were raised from noon to 2 p.m., 4 to 5 p.m. and 8 to 10 p.m.Mindanao’s peak demand was estimated at 2,591 MW, while available capacity stood at 2,641 MW.NGCP said 31 power plants in Mindanao were on forced outage and eight others were operating at reduced capacity, leaving 827.7 MW unavailable to the grid.
